LMN-3 Emulator, Github Discussions, and Group Buy Poll
Hey everyone, I just wanted to provide a quick look at the emulator, as well as mention the new Github discussion page and the poll for gauging interest in a group buy for PCBs/cases. Please smash that star button on the github repos if you haven't already :)
Note the emulator and DAW releases in the respective Github repos were compiled for Linux only. If you want to run them on a different OS, you will need to compile it yourself. I make no guarantees it will even work on Mac or Windows, as I dont have access to those operating systems currently (but in theory it should work if you can get MIDI loopback working for the emulator)
